Er, I think Guilherme may just be asking for a backport, and
wheezy-backports *is* open for uploads for packages that will almost
certainly be in jessie. At least at first glance, emacs24 would seem to
qualify, if someone felt like doing the work.
So I think this is a reasonable request, although I don't know if anyone
has the time to work on it right now.
Note, though, that emacs24 has all sorts of possible implications for
other elisp packages, so it may be a touch difficult to use a backport
effectively.
